    • Prior to application, unzip garment and use brush, with cap in closed position, to remove sand, mud and other debris.
    • Remove grit from brush before lubricating zipper.
    • Open cap and brush generous amount of Zip Care onto zipper teeth.
    • Reapply regularly, especially before storage periods.
    • Close cap and rinse brush after use.

    FOR BEST RESULTS: Use Zip Care in conjunction with Zip Tech™ or Max Wax™ Zipper Lubricants.

    REPAIR YOUR OUTERWEAR

    Seam Grip® permanently repairs common pinholes and tears in your outerwear. Apply just enough Seam Grip to cover the hole and spread 1/4” (6 mm) beyond. Allow to dry level overnight. For 2-4 hour cure time, mix Seam Grip with Cotol-240™plus before applying.

    KNIFE TIP

    To sharpen a knife, slide the knife across the sharpening stone as though you are trying to cut a thin slice off the stone. Hold the blade at roughly a 20 degree angle and draw it steadily. Be sure to count the number of strokes and do the same number of strokes on the opposite side.
